Zambia coach Herve Renard: I am the chosen one
The elated Frenchman has given himself the moniker as the chosen one for Africa after leading the Chipolopolo to the 2012 Afcon triumph

Zambia coach Herve Renard has likened himself to Real Madrid coach Jose Mourinho, boasting that he is the chosen one.
The Frenchman has every reason to be a happy man after having led underdogs the Chipolopolo to their first ever trophy at the 2012 Africa Cup of Nations.
The southern Africans edged out pre-tournaments favourites Cote d’Ivoire in an epic 8-7 penalty shootout in Libreville.
Renard told the press he deserves the accolade as Africa’s best trainer for bringing the coveted trophy to the copper-rich country.
“I’m the chosen one! I am the only one,” the former Ghana assistant coach screamed. “I am Africa’s chosen coach.”
Renard took over as coach of the 2010 quarter-finalists after Italian Dario Bonnetti was booted out some weeks before the 28th edition of the Nations Cup. His team beat favourites Senegal and Ghana before defeating the rampaging Elephants in the final.
